Ingredients List
Gathering your ingredients is the first step to lobster tail perfection! Here’s what you’ll need to make this mouthwatering dish:
- 2 lobster tails
- 2 tablespoons melted butter
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ste

How to Prepare Lobster Tail in Air Fryer
Preparing lobster tails in an air fryer is a breeze, and I’m here to walk you through the steps to make it as simple and delicious as possible! Let’s get started, shall we?
Preheat the Air Fryer
First things first, preheating your air fryer is crucial! This step ensures that your lobster tails cook evenly and get that lovely golden finish. Set your air fryer to 380°F (193°C) and let it heat up for about 5 minutes. Trust me, this little extra time makes a big difference!
Prepare the Lobster Tails
Now, let’s get to the lobster tails! Carefully split them down the middle using kitchen shears. You want to expose that beautiful meat but keep the shell intact for presentation. Next, brush the melted butter all over the lobster meat—this is where the flavor magic happens! Then, sprinkle on the garlic powder, paprika, and a pinch of salt and pepper to taste. Make sure every bit of that luscious meat is coated; it’ll soak up all those delicious spices!
Cooking Time and Temperature
Once your lobster tails are prepped and ready to go, place them in the air fryer basket, shell side down. Cook for about 8-10 minutes. You’ll know they’re done when the meat is opaque and firm to the touch. If you want to be extra sure, a quick poke with a fork should reveal that tender goodness! Tips for Success
To nail those lobster tails every single time, here are my top tips! First, adjust your cooking time based on the size of the tails—smaller ones will need closer to 8 minutes, while larger ones might take the full 10 minutes. You can also try adding a splash of lemon juice or a sprinkle of fresh herbs like parsley for an extra burst of flavor. And if you’re feeling adventurous, switch up the spices! A dash of cayenne or some Old Bay seasoning can give your tails a delightful kick. Trust me, you’ll be the lobster tail expert in no time!

Can I use frozen lobster tails?
Absolutely! You can use frozen lobster tails; just make sure to thaw them completely before cooking. The best way to do this is to leave them in the refrigerator overnight. If you’re short on time, you can also submerge them in cold water for about 30 minutes. Once they’re thawed, follow the same prep steps as fresh tails, and they’ll turn out just as delicious!

How do I know when lobster tails are done?
Checking for doneness is super simple! You’ll know your lobster tails are ready when the meat turns opaque and feels firm to the touch. If you’re unsure, you can use a fork to poke the meat; it should flake easily and be tender. Another great tip? The shells will turn a beautiful bright red when they’re fully cooked, so keep an eye on that too!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
If you happen to have any leftover lobster tails (which is rare, but it happens!), you’ll want to store them properly to keep that delicious flavor intact. First, let them cool completely, then w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or foil and place them in an airtight container. They’ll st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
For reheating, the best method is to use your air fryer again! Simply preheat it to 350°F (175°C) and warm the lobster tails for about 5 minutes, until heated through. This way, you’ll retain that juicy texture and flavor. Enjoy your gourmet leftovers!

Lobster Tail Air Fryer: 5 Simple Steps to Deliciousness
- Total Time: 20 minutes
- Yield: 2 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
Delicious lobster tails cooked in an air fryer.
Ingredients
- 2 lobster tails
- 2 tablespoons melted butter
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at the air fryer to 380°F (193°C).
- Split the lobster tails down the middle.
- Brush melted butter on the lobster meat.
- Sprinkle gar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per over the tails.
- Place lobster tails in the air fryer basket.
- Cook for 8-10 minutes until the meat is opaque and cooked through.
- Remove from air fryer and serve immediately.
Notes
- Adjust cooking time based on the size of the tails.
- Serve with lemon wedges for extra flavor.
